Onboarding — Reset Flow Revamp (Support). Tindral's password reset moved to the new Kestrelgate flow last quarter. Key changes: links expire in 15 minutes, one active link per account, and lockouts clear automatically after 30 minutes. Escalate only if a customer reports a loop on the confirmation screen. For verified escalations, support leads can unlock the override console in the Brightmoor admin panel. The console prompts once; enter the recovery passphrase shown below.

unlock words, fahop-yageg: ralwyn-kelath

FACILITIES TICKET — Key cabinet, pool cars. New starters: pool car keys for Varnell House live in the grey cabinet behind reception, level 1. Sign keys out in the logbook, return by 17:30. Do not leave keys in vehicles. Report missing keys to Facilities immediately. To open the cabinet, enter the code below.

door code, yagap-bahof: bdg-O-05

## Static Analysis Baseline

Lintgate scans every merge request against `baseline.lintgate.json`. Do not edit the baseline by hand; run `lintgate freeze` after fixing findings. CI fetches the baseline store using credentials from your local `.env`. Copy `.env.sample` first, then confirm `LINTGATE_BASELINE_BUCKET=lintgate-baselines-prod` is present. Immediately below that, add the line that sets the baseline store access secret.

env line for kaguf-hahop: COURIER_KEY29=2e2fa9479f98362396e2c28f86fc9